The Fennwick Relay service emits high-volume logs, so the `/v2/sampling` endpoint lets plugin authors set per-category sample rates between 0.001 and 1.0. Rates apply within sixty seconds and persist across restarts. All sampling configuration requests must be authenticated; include the bearer token shown below in the Authorization header of every call.

bearer token for hahif-tafog: eyJhbGciOiJIUzI1NiIsInR5cCI6IkpXVCJ9.eyJzdWIiOiIK-h47iIewNIn0.fxe2zI4PI_zk

## Environments — Sweepwright Retention Sweeper

Quick refresher for the sync: the sweeper runs in three environments — sandbox (dry-run only), staging (deletes against synthetic tenants), and prod (real deletions, double-confirmed). Staging got its own queue last sprint, so backlogs there no longer block prod runs. Sandbox still shares a database with the Fennicut test suite, which is fine for now. Current staging configuration is below.

config for tagep-yajef:
ulawyn:
  log_level: error
  metrics_host: metrics.ulawyn.lumiclabs.internal
  pin: 0564
  pool_size: 32

## Getting Started with Rendermule Plugins

Welcome aboard! Rendermule's transcoding farm hands your plugin a job manifest and expects encoded segments back on the callback queue. Before your plugin can claim jobs, it needs to authenticate with the dispatch node — otherwise every claim gets bounced with a polite refusal. Pop open your local `.env` file and add this line:

secret setting of bajeg-yahog: LEDGER_TOKEN20=f833f3e2e6625ec0dee3

**Action item (P2):** All user-facing dates in Kestrelpad must render via the locale service, not hardcoded formats. The outage happened because cached format strings went stale after a locale pack update. Audit every template, then set cache TTLs conservatively. The cache and fallback constants we settled on are below.

tuning table, yajog-yahof:
BUDGETS = {
    "lamvan": 303,
    "wenox": 460,
    "fenvan": 525,
}